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Kuga

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

Ford Kuga has a noticeable advantage in terms of price – it starts at 34200 £, while the Volvo EX40 costs 42800 £. That’s a price difference of around 8606 £.

As for range, the Volvo EX40 performs significantly better – achieving up to 576 km, about 508 km more than the Ford Kuga.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.

When it comes to engine power, the Volvo EX40 has a clearly edge – offering 442 HP compared to 243 HP. That’s roughly 199 HP more horsepower.

In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Volvo EX40 is significantly quicker – completing the sprint in 4.60 s, while the Ford Kuga takes 7.30 s. That’s about 2.70 s faster.

In terms of top speed, the Ford Kuga performs hardly perceptible better – reaching 200 km/h, while the Volvo EX40 tops out at 180 km/h. The difference is around 20 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: Volvo EX40 pulls convincingly stronger with 670 Nm compared to 240 Nm. That’s about 430 Nm difference.

Space and Everyday Use:

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In curb weight, Ford Kuga is distinct lighter – 1526 kg compared to 2040 kg. The difference is around 514 kg.

In terms of boot space, the Ford Kuga offers barely noticeable more room – 412 L compared to 410 L. That’s a difference of about 2 L.

In maximum load capacity, the Ford Kuga performs minimal better – up to 1534 L, which is about 134 L more than the Volvo EX40.

When it comes to payload, Ford Kuga a bit takes the win – 550 kg compared to 480 kg. That’s a difference of about 70 kg.

The Kuga is Ford’s adaptable family SUV that blends usable space with a surprisingly lively driving character, making daily commutes and weekend escapes equally enjoyable. With smart interior packaging, an easy-to-use infotainment setup and composed road manners, it’s a sensible choice for buyers who want a bit of fun without the fuss.

The Volvo EX40 wraps Scandinavian calm and clever practicality into a compact electric package that feels both premium and refreshingly uncomplicated. It's the grown-up answer to flashier rivals — a safe, comfy, and city-friendly EV with thoughtful tech that makes everyday driving quietly satisfying.
